Cluster synthesis using a methoxymethylidyne template

Abstract

H2Ru3(CO)93-COMe){Rh(CO)2PPh3} rearranges with loss of CO to form H2Ru3Rh(CO)10PPh3(µ-COMe) from which the Me group can be abstracted thus forming [H2Ru3Rh(CO)11PPh3].
